what front tire do I need

What front tire do I need to run with Mickey Thompson 305 45 17 et Street. R to keep my anti-lock brake light from coming on when I'm at the track thanks for any help

You should be pretty close to stock height with those tires right about 28". Stock fronts or skinnies on 4.5' wide Rims will do.

I have MT 28x6.0x17 Skinnies up front on a 4.5 inch wide wheel and 305/45-R17 MT Street R on the rear.

This setup is very popular at the Drag Strip

Pull the fuses at the track, put them back when you leave.
I run the same as WoodBoss but will be swapping to the new MT ET Street R 315/50*17 soon. It is 29.4" tall.
